Position

Registered Nurse (Experienced) — Duke University Hospital — Operating Room Service Line Coordinator

Duke University Health System seeks to hire a Clinical Nurse II who will embrace our mission of Transforming Lives Transforming Care.

Shift: Day shift, primarily weekday coverage

Responsibilities
  • Support patient care and facilitate activities and processes associated with the OR daily schedule, special equipment, instrumentation, inventory, and preference cards for selected surgical service line(s).
  • Coordinate with care teams to ensure smooth day-to-day room flow and real-time troubleshooting of schedule or equipment issues.
  • Serve as a frontline resource and escalation point during complex cases; act as a knowledgeable clinical resource for the team.
  • Lead intra-day operations related to case coordination and surgeon preference management; support surgical scheduling and coordination efforts.
  • Maintain strong communication with surgeons, anesthesia, nursing, and support services.
Qualifications
  • Strong OR operational knowledge, especially neurosurgery workflows and instrumentation.
  • Experience with surgical scheduling, case coordination, and surgeon preference management.
  • Familiarity with supply and implant workflows and coordination with supply chain teams.
  • Ability to lead day-to-day room flow and troubleshoot schedule or equipment issues in real time.
  • Strong communication skills for working with surgeons, anesthesia, nursing, and support services.
  • Experience with process improvement and data-driven decision making (QSight experience is a plus).
  • Comfort serving as a frontline resource and escalation point during complex cases.
  • Clinical OR experience and demonstrated leadership or charge experience are strongly preferred.

Education

Bachelor of Science degree in Nursing required.

Experience

Two or more years of OR experience.

Degrees, Licensures, Certifications

Must have current or compact RN license in the State of North Carolina. BCLS certification is required. CNOR certification preferred.
